With the rounding of Point Conception on 8/10/02, I completed what I am
calling "The Southern California Sea Kayaking Grand Slam." This accomplishment
consisted of paddling the entire coast of Southern California (Point
Conception to the Mexican border), circumnavigating the six publicly
accessible Channel Islands (Catalina, Santa Barbara, Anacapa, Santa Cruz,
Santa Rosa and San Miguel), and crossing to these six Channel Islands. The
quest began in 1999 and was completed piecemeal.
